M9 section S1, commit 2. Add src/thoughtsync/responses.py — the app's single
JSON-error shape and the two guards that pair with it:
  - json_error(message, status): the one ({"error": ...}, code) builder
  - not_found(): the standard 404, by far the most common note-route error
  - parse_uuid(raw): parse a path/body id, None on malformed → pair with not_found()

notes.py adopts them everywhere: ~25 hand-built `jsonify({"error":"not found"}),404`
collapse to not_found(); ~20 other error returns to json_error(...); ~13 repeated
`try: uuid.UUID(x) except: ...` blocks to parse_uuid(). Behavior-preserving — same
bodies and status codes, one definition. jsonify stays for the success responses.

Other blueprints (auth, labels, saved_filters, sync, settings_api) adopt the same
helpers in their own M9 sections.

from __future__ import annotations
import uuid
from quart import jsonify
# The app's single JSON error shape + the two guards that pair with it, so every
# blueprint returns errors and parses path ids the same way instead of hand-building
# `jsonify({"error": ...}), code` and try/except uuid blocks at ~35 call sites.
def json_error(message: str, status: int):
"""A JSON error body + status: ({"error": message}, status)."""
return jsonify({"error": message}), status
def not_found():
"""404 with the standard body — by far the most common error in the note routes."""
return json_error("not found", 404)
def parse_uuid(raw: object) -> uuid.UUID | None:
"""Parse a path/body UUID, returning None on anything malformed. Pair with
not_found() for the ubiquitous 'bad id in the URL → 404' guard."""
try:
return uuid.UUID(str(raw))
except (ValueError, TypeError):
return None
